Rationalise the denominator and simplify `(5sqrt(3) + sqrt(2))/(sqrt(3) + sqrt(2))`

उत्तर
`(5sqrt(3) + sqrt(2))/(sqrt(3) + sqrt(2)) = ((5sqrt(3) + sqrt(2))(sqrt(3) - sqrt(2)))/((sqrt(3) + sqrt(2))(sqrt(3) - sqrt(2))`
= `(5(3) - 5sqrt(3) xx sqrt(2) + (sqrt(2)sqrt(3) - (2)))/((sqrt(3))^2 - (sqrt(2))^2`
= `(15 - 5sqrt(6) + sqrt(6) - 2)/(3 - 2)`
= `(13 - 4sqrt(6))/1`
= `13 - 4sqrt(6)`
